How to reduction of antinutritional factor at pulses?
5 answers
Reduction of antinutritional factors in pulses can be achieved through various processing methods. Traditional techniques like soaking, dehulling, boiling, germination, and fermentation are effective in decreasing compounds such as phytate, protease inhibitors, phenolics, tannins, lectins, and saponins. Innovative methods like extrusion, microwave heating, and micronization have also shown promise in reducing antinutrient content, although results vary. Pressure cooking, among homemade methods, has been reported to result in the most significant reduction of antinutritional factors in pulses. However, it is important to note that while these processing techniques are valuable in reducing antinutritional factors, they can also have adverse effects on the protein content of pulses, particularly affecting albumin, globulin, and total proteins.

What are some studies on critical congenital heart disease?
5 answers
Studies on critical congenital heart disease (CCHD) have explored various aspects related to diagnosis, management, and outcomes. One study in Kerala established a neonatal heart disease registry, revealing that systematic screening, including pulse oximetry, aids in early identification and management of critical CHD, but challenges like low prostaglandin use contribute to preoperative mortality. Another study highlighted the impact of prenatal diagnosis on preoperative status and postoperative outcomes, indicating that while prenatal diagnosis optimizes preoperative clinical status, it may lead to less favorable postoperative outcomes. Additionally, a study in Shanghai found that specialist pediatric cardiac transfer can reduce inotropic drug use, unplanned surgeries, and mortality rates, emphasizing the importance of specialized care for neonates with CCHD.

What about behaviour in epidemic control?
5 answers
Individual behavior plays a crucial role in epidemic control, as highlighted in various research papers. Behavioral changes such as self-quarantine, self-protection, and social distancing significantly impact the spread and size of epidemics. The dynamics of infections and deaths during a pandemic are heavily influenced by public and private behaviors, which can either exacerbate or mitigate the impact of the disease outbreak. Distancing measures reduce infection probabilities but come with associated costs, affecting the epidemic's trajectory and final size. Heterogeneous behavioral responses, driven by risk perceptions and individual beliefs, can lead to trade-offs in epidemic control efforts, emphasizing the complexity of individual decision-making in epidemic scenarios. Understanding and incorporating these behavioral aspects are essential for effective epidemic control strategies.
